Chen Duo was a character in the Chinese web comic " Under One Man " and its derivative works. She appeared in the fourth season. She was the Gu Body Saint Child of the Medicine Immortal Association. She was originally a temporary worker in South China and one of the twelve upper root artifacts of Green Touring Village. In the fourth season, Chen Duo was suspected of killing Liao Zhong, the person in charge of the South China region, and then escaped. In the end, she poisoned herself to death in front of the temporary workers in the six regions and Zhang Chulan. Chen Duo's background was very pitiful, and her story attracted the attention and sympathy of readers. In the manga, Chen Duo's image and character experience were deeply portrayed, leaving a deep impression on people. Her fate was unsolvable. This was also the difference between Under One Man and other comics.
Chen Duo was a character in the Chinese webcomic " Under One Man " and its derivative works. She was also the main character in the fourth season of " Under One Man." She was originally a temporary worker in South China, and later became the Gu Body Saint Child of the Medicine Immortal Association. In the plot, Chen Duo killed Liao Zhong, the person in charge of the South China region, and then escaped. In the end, she poisoned herself to death in front of the temporary workers in the six regions and Zhang Chulan. Chen Duo's setting was a character isolated from society. She had suffered inhuman abuse since she was young and longed for the right to choose her own life. She had chosen death, and at the last moment, she had obtained the right to choose. She felt happy and satisfied. Chen Duo's story brought shock and thought to the readers. She was a pure and beautiful soul.
